Narcissus ‘Greenore’


Description:

Mid-season historic daffodil, 2 W-WWY [Large-Cupped], is a tall cultivar over 67.5 cm, hybridised by J. Lionel Richardson in Ireland and registered before 1937. Bred from White Sentinel × Fortune, it has very broad, rounded perianth segments overlapping half, with slightly narrower inner segments. The cup-shaped corona is pale primrose with a greenish-lemon rim and a slightly expanded mouth. A classic elegant large-cupped beauty.

Threat Status: Threatened In Cultivation As assessed by the Plant Heritage Threatened Plants Programme. For more details see www.plantheritage.org.uk/conservation/threatened-plants/
